  • Patent number: 8234492
    Abstract: Provided are a method, client and system for reservation access to a management server using a one-time password. A generated personal identification number (PIN) is transmitted to the management server when a reservation time comes. The management server generates a random number encrypted using the PIN and transmits the random number to the client. The random number encrypted using the PIN is received, the received random number is encrypted by a symmetric-key algorithm using a client secret key and is transmitted to the management server. The management server receives the random number encrypted using the client secret key, and decrypts the received random number using a server secret key and the PIN. A random number before the encryption using the PIN is compared with a decrypted random number, and access of the client is accepted if the two numbers are identical.

  • Patent number: 8199849
    Abstract: Provided are a data transmitting device transmitting data through a delay insensitive data transmitting method and a data transmitting method. The data transmitting device and the data transmitting method use the delay insensitive data transmitting method supporting a 2-phase hand shake protocol. During data transmission, data are encoded into three logic state having no space state through a ternary encoding method. According to the data transmitting device and the data transmitting method, data are stably transmitted to a receiver regardless of the length of a wire, and provides more excellent performance in an aspect of a data transmission rate, compared to a related art 4-phase delay data transmitting method.

  • Patent number: 8166219
    Abstract: Provided is a bus signal encoding/decoding method and apparatus. The bus signal encoding method includes receiving a bus signal, XOR-operating all but the first byte sequence of the bus signal in a bitwise manner, inverting the even-numbered byte sequences of the XOR-operated bus signal in a bitwise manner, and serializing the inverted bus signal.
